Yosemite 10.10 and After Effects CC - Opens, but only the render que.

Downloaded the Yosemite beta 2 the other day, not thinking about how all programs would work or not. So, all adobe programs open just fine, except for After effects. I've heard others having problems opening it - my problem is bit different.
After effects opens up, but almost all menu options is greyed out, and nothing is clickable. The only window that opens is the render que. Is there any way to fix this? I can't find anything on google.
Another problem is that the ray tracing doesn't seem to find my GPU. I got my Geforce GT 750M included in that Ray tracing list file, if that makes any difference.
Frej Fallqvist

You have opened After Effects in Render Engine mode.
Don't double-click the icon in the application folder named Adobe After Effects Render Engine.
Remove any file named ae_render_only_node.txt in your Documents folder, as detailed here:
http://blogs.adobe.com/aftereffects/2012/06/codecs-and-the-render-engine-in-after-effects- cs6.html

  • I started a creative cloud student membership but Premiere Pro and After Effects are not in the app

    I started a creative cloud student membership but Premiere Pro and After Effects are not in the app and won't download from the adobe website, all that happens is that the creative cloud app opens and sends me to the list of programs available for download which still do not contain Premiere Pro and After Effects

    Premiere Pro and After Effects are 64 bit only apps.
    They require a 64 bit computer and a 64 bit operating system.
    If you're running Windows 7 32 bit or Windows 8 32 bit then you will not be able to download, install or run Premiere Pro or After Effects.
    See http://www.adobe.com/products/creativecloud/faq.html#desktop-products
    Which desktop applications in Creative Cloud require 64-bit operating systems?
    With the new CC apps, most of the pro video and audio applications now require 64-bit operating systems to run. These native 64-bit applications include Adobe Premiere® Pro CC, Adobe Audition® CC, After Effects® CC, Prelude® CC, and SpeedGrade® CC. Flash Professional CC, Photoshop CC and Lightroom® also require 64-bit on Mac OS.

  • Final Cut and After Effects "file is busy"

    Hello All-
    I am running Final Cut Pro 5.1.4 and After Effects 7.0.1 Pro (on OS 10.4.8) and I have a question. I have a series of After Effects animated DV Quicktime clips edited together in Final Cut, and when I make changes to the After Effects project files and try to rerender, I get an error:
    After Effects error: unable to overwrite - file is busy (delete) (-47) ( 3 :: 3 )
    It's like Final Cut is "holding onto" the files and not allowing After Effects to rerender them. If I close down Final Cut, I can rerender just fine, but this gets real annoying closing it down and restarting it every time I need to rerender a clip. The problem is, because of my workflow, I need to do this dozens of times a day with clients in the room and I'm spending a lot of time closing and restarting Final Cut over the course of a day... is there way to do this without closing down Final Cut?
    I assigned After Effects to be the "External Editor" for "Video Files", and used Final Cut's "Open In Editor" command. It sends the quicktime file to After Effects (not exactly what I want) and you would think that at this point Final Cut would have relenquished its access to the file so that I could rerender in After Effects, but nope, I still get the error. I have tried this with the User Preference setting "Always Reconnect Externally Modified Files" both on and off, no difference. I have also tried "Embed Project Link" in After Effects's quicktime output options, but this didn't help anything (I believe this only affects other Adobe apps).
    The weird part of this is that when I drop a Photoshop file onto the Final Cut timeline, I can do "Open in Editor", it throws it to Photoshop, I can alter it and save with no problem, and pop back into Final Cut and it will be updated. But no such luck with Quicktime files and After Effects.
    Let me know if there is a solution to this, or if I am stuck having to shut down Final Cut every single time I need to rerender one of the After Effects animation clips in the timeline.
    - Bob Wilson
    MacBook Pro 2.33ghz Core 2 Duo 15"   Mac OS X (10.4.8)   3 gigs ram, 160 gig HD

    What i have to suggest is more of a work around than it is a solution. i've had this problem off and on as well. What i do is add a number to the name of the newly rendered file, (ie. "monkey_throwspoo2.mov") import that file into FCP, open it in the viewer, and then copy it (apple + c). Provided it's the smae length as the previous file, you can right click on the previous file in the timeline and paste attributes, making sure to click on the content button for video (and audio if there is any). This should replace the old file in the timeline with the new one. Granted, you end up having a bunch of files that you're not using, but it's faster than restarting Final Cut (and looks more like it's something you're doing on purpose rather than a problem with the program to your clients).
